China Shaanxi Xi'an Baidu Cloud
Websites on 106.12.252.60
- Domain names that have been bound:
- 2023-08-15-----2025-12-27nc.xaidc.com
- 2023-08-15-----2025-12-20c.xaidc.com
- 2024-12-17-----2024-12-17nc.meaningfulcloud.com
- website server lookup history
- 5522444.com
- www.4433w.com
- 5633.com
- 55892.net
- httpswww.18mo.com
- jamovs.com
- www.99pbhc.com
- fckbj.com
- weichuangiot.com
- 5475.com
- gzbxjxsb.com
- 5469556.com
- yklx.top
- yoursusdt.com
- 502495.com
- 3605429.7788mp3www.cc
- img.534zw.com
- 546.cc
- 86mm.com
- www.zzkpp.com
- hosting ip address lookup history
- 52.68.18.9
- 154.205.80.235
- 154.210.38.206
- 220.196.52.191
- 104.19.239.223
- 52.213.239.101
- 38.239.189.58
- 88.70.250.244
- 156.237.249.38
- 54.69.191.170
- 213.110.204.17
- 111.77.47.240
- 23.236.104.12
- 137.220.225.32
- 38.6.114.56
- 120.226.187.179
- 104.148.61.248
- 45.38.203.46
- 45.199.5.61
- 8.129.227.149
